DEPENDABLE STRENGTH. With a strong, welded steel build, this class 2 hitch is rated for 3,500 lbs. gross trailer weight and 300 lbs. tongue weight (limited to lowest-rated towing component)
HIGHLY VERSATILE. This class 2 trailer hitch kit has a standard 1-1/4-inch receiver and includes a ball mount with a 3/4-inch hole, allowing you to tow a small trailer or mount a cargo carrier or bike rack (trailer ball sold separately)
DUAL-COAT FINISH. For industry-leading rust, chip and UV resistance inside and out, this tow hitch is submersed in a liquid A-coat and co-cured with a durable black powder coat finish
EASY INSTALLATION. This class 2 hitch kit fits select model years of the Subaru Legacy and Outback
TESTED FOR SAFETY. Each CURT class 2 trailer hitch design is thoroughly tested at our Detroit facility, using real vehicles in real-world conditions. Our hitches are tested to SAE J684 specs to give you confidence and safety on the road ahead

This CURT class 2 hitch is perfect for towing a small trailer, such as a boat trailer, lightweight camper or utility trailer. It can also be used to mount a hitch cargo carrier or bike rack (never exceed the lowest-rated towing component). Like all CURT custom hitches, this class 2 trailer hitch is made for a vehicle-specific fit. It is engineered to seamlessly integrate with select years of the Subaru Legacy and Outback (see application info to verify fitment). It is rated for 3,500 pounds gross trailer weight and 300 pounds tongue weight. It is also equipped with 1-1/4" x 1-1/4" hitch receiver to accept the included ball mount. The ball mount that comes with this hitch kit has a 3/4" trailer ball hole and can be positioned in the drop or rise orientation for level towing with your specific trailer (trailer ball not included). Like all CURT custom receiver hitches, this class 2 hitch is designed, manufactured, finished and tested with the utmost care. It is engineered for a precise fit, easy installation, maximum towing strength and an integrated look on the vehicle. It is also tested to SAE J684 protocols for safety. This class 2 trailer hitch is finished with our industry-leading dual-coat process for unparalleled rust, chip and UV resistance. It is descaled for a smooth surface, submersed in liquid A-coat for rust prevention inside and out, covered with a highly durable powder coat, and finally co-cured for a dependable shield against the elements. This class 2 hitch comes with a ball mount, hitch pin and mounting hardware for a complete installation.

This receiver fit my 2006 Subaru Legacy GT sedan -almost- perfectly. I was able to install it myself (although without a lift it was a bit of a challenge) in about an hour. The only problem I had was that the last bolt you install, which keeps the tow-arm from moving up and down, didn't quite fit. They provide a large rectangular steel washer that when used, doesn't line up correctly with support ring on the car.
I fixed this issue by buying two large washers from a hardware store that fit better, but are probably much weaker than the large steel washer they provide (fortunately I'm only towing about 300lbs). I eventually took the car to a friend of mine who is a car mechanic for some maintenance. He complimented me on the installation and even tightened the bolts a bit with a torque wrench (which was recommended but I didn't have one). He also offered to cut the steel washer a bit so that it could still be used, but I didn't have it with me at the time.
Regardless I have already used it a couple times to tow a small aluminum fishing boat and it has worked great!
Note: 2006 Subaru Legacy GT sedan does NOT come with a connector for the tow lights (the wagon does). You will need to buy a control unit separately and do some wire splicing to get it to work.

The hitch is fine, installed relatively easily on my 2007 Outback wagon, but there were some differences in my vehicle and the install instructions which could be a show stopper if you don't have the right tools available. There is a bracket attached to the car frame that interfered with the hitch. My bracket had an extended tab (as shown in the picture) that was unlike the bracket shown in the instructions. I used a grinder to remove the extra tab, and everything went together fine (second picture).

Easy to install, works like a charm. As others have noted, on an Outback wagon there is a bumper support bracket that will need modification to be re-installed. Nothing 5 minutes with a cut-off wheel didn't handle. Overall, a 20 minute install, but I have a lift and power tools to make it easy. On my back in a driveway without air tools, it would have taken maybe an hour tops.
